Toyota Highlander: Top Competitors & Alternatives for 2024

Toyota Highlander Alternatives

The Toyota Highlander continues to be a popular choice in the midsize SUV segment thanks to its reputation for reliability, contemporary design, and versatile interior.

However, the Highlander faces stiff competition from models like the Chevrolet Traverse, Honda Pilot, Hyundai Palisade, and Kia Telluride.

These competitors often offer better on-road feedback, larger third rows, and in some cases, better warranties or lower starting prices.

Toyota Highlander Top Competitors Comparison Summary

Chevrolet Traverse: Known for its generous passenger space across all three rows and a much larger overall interior compared to the Highlander. It features a smooth V6 and a well-tuned nine-speed automatic transmission but falls short in fuel economy.

Honda Pilot: Praised for its versatile interior design, smooth ride quality, and excellent all-weather driving capabilities. It offers a roomier third row than the Highlander and smart storage solutions, though access to the third row and cargo space can be limiting.

Hyundai Palisade: Entered the market with a large interior, plenty of technology features, and an adult-usable third row. It drives like a smaller vehicle with good visibility and maneuverability, though its fuel economy and lack of a hybrid option may deter some buyers.

Kia Telluride: Launched as a benchmark for the three-row crossover-SUV class with an impressive list of standard features, the largest interior in its class, and great styling. It boasts impressive fuel economy and an excellent warranty, though interior storage is not as well-designed as some rivals.

1. Chevrolet Traverse vs Toyota Highlander

Chevrolet-Traverse-Alternatives-to-Toyota-HighlanderDesign and Performance: Both offer contemporary designs, but the Traverse was refreshed for a bolder look. The Highlander's 3.5-liter V6 is matched by the Traverse's smooth V6 and well-tuned nine-speed automatic transmission.

Interior Space: The Traverse boasts more generous passenger space in all three rows and a larger overall interior compared to the Highlander.

Fuel Efficiency: The Highlander has an edge with its hybrid option, offering up to 36 mpg, whereas the Traverse falls short in fuel economy for the class.

Overall Value: While both have similar warranties, the Traverse's larger interior might appeal to families needing more space, but the Highlander's fuel efficiency and reliability could sway buyers.

2. Honda Pilot vs Toyota Highlander

Honda-Pilot-Alternatives-to-Toyota-HighlanderDesign and Performance: Both vehicles offer smooth ride quality, but the Pilot is known for its all-weather driving capabilities thanks to its AWD options.

Interior Space: The Pilot features a roomier third row than the Highlander and smart storage solutions, though the Highlander's hybrid option offers better fuel efficiency.

Fuel Efficiency: The Highlander's hybrid model significantly outperforms the Pilot in fuel economy.

Overall Value: The Pilot and Highlander are closely matched in price, but the Pilot's interior versatility and the Highlander's fuel efficiency make them appeal to slightly different buyers.

3. Hyundai Palisade vs Toyota Highlander

Hyundai-Palisade-Alternatives-to-Toyota-HighlanderDesign and Performance: The Palisade offers a large interior with an adult-usable third row and drives like a smaller vehicle. The Highlander is praised for its smooth highway ride and fuel-efficient hybrid option.

Interior Space: The Palisade's interior is competitive with the Highlander's, offering plenty of technology features and space.

Fuel Efficiency: The Highlander's hybrid option gives it a significant advantage over the Palisade, which lacks a hybrid model and has a slightly lower real-world fuel economy.

Overall Value: The Palisade's warranty surpasses the Highlander's, making it a strong contender for those prioritizing long-term coverage and interior space over fuel efficiency.

4. Kia Telluride vs Toyota Highlander

Kia-Telluride-Alternatives-to-Toyota-HighlanderDesign and Performance: The Telluride sets a high bar with its impressive list of standard features, large interior, and great styling. The Highlander, however, offers a reliable and fuel-efficient hybrid option.

Interior Space: The Telluride boasts the largest interior in this comparison, with seating for adults even in the third row, whereas the Highlander's third row is more suited for children.

Fuel Efficiency: The Highlander's hybrid model is unmatched by the Telluride in terms of fuel economy, despite the Telluride's impressive performance.

Overall Value: The Telluride's warranty and value proposition make it a top pick, but the Highlander's fuel efficiency and reliability are strong selling points for eco-conscious buyers.
